Kaiser Chiefs Live at Webster Hall Performing I Predict a Riot
In June 2014, Kaiser Chiefs performed live at Webster Hall, a significant venue in New York City, during a unique phase in their career. The band's fourth studio album, "Education, Education, Education & War," had been released just a few months prior in April 2014. The album marked a vibrant comeback for the band, which had faced some ups and downs in recent years. During this live recording, they treated fans to energetic renditions of their chart-topping hits, like "I Predict a Riot," showcasing not just their trademark sound but also an ability to engage with the crowd. Interestingly, this performance came at a time when the Chiefs were reclaiming their place in the rock scene after nearly a decade since their breakthrough. By diving into new themes while staying true to their roots, this concert captured a pivotal moment in their ongoing journey.
